Zeroing in on Shoulder Pain: Mastering Hijama Points for Effective Relief

Shoulder pain can be a debilitating condition, hampering your daily activities and overall quality of life. Traditional medicine often employs medications and physical therapy to manage the discomfort, but many individuals explore alternative healing modalities for more lasting relief. Hijama, also known as cupping therapy, is an ancient practice that utilizes suction cups to stimulate blood flow and ease pain in specific areas of the body, including the shoulders.

Strategically placed hijama points on the back and shoulders can significantly target the underlying reasons of shoulder pain, such as muscle tension, nerve compression, or inflammation. These locations are believed to align to specific nerves and meridians in the body, allowing for a holistic approach to healing.

  • Therapists skilled in hijama therapy can determine the most suitable points for your individual needs based on the type and severity of your shoulder pain.
  • During a hijama session, sterile cups are gently placed on the targeted points and suction is applied, inducing mild vacuum pressure. This suction enhances blood flow to the area, delivering essential nutrients and oxygen to promote healing.
  • After a hijama treatment, many individuals report significant reductions in shoulder pain, stiffness, and inflammation.

Effective Therapies, Natural Solutions: Hijama Cupping for Modern Wellness

Ancient practices continue to offer effective solutions for modern wellness concerns. One such practice, Hijama cupping, is gaining traction for its ability to promote holistic well-being. Hijama, also known as wet cupping, involves the application of suction cups to specific points on the body to activate blood flow and energy circulation.

This technique is believed to relieve a wide range of ailments, including muscle tension, headaches, and even chronic pain. Practitioners employ sterilized cups to draw up stagnant blood and toxins, promoting restoration at a cellular level.

The benefits of Hijama extend beyond the material. Many individuals report experiencing an increase in energy levels, improved mood, and a greater sense of balance after a session.
